Numerical solution of Volterra Integro-Differential Equations by hybrid block with quadrature rules method
In this paper, the implementation of one-step hybrid block method with quadrature rules will be proposed for solving linear and non-linear rst order Volterra Integro-Di erential Equations (VIDEs) of the second kind.
